Purchasing Power Analysis

A Mechanical Engineers in Appleton, WI earns $66,450 in nominal terms, which is 14.6% below the national average of $77,792. After adjusting for the local cost of living (index 95.1 vs national 100), this is equivalent to $69,874 in national-average purchasing power.

Tax differences are not included. Only cost-of-living index adjustments are applied.
